Proposed Brine Treatment Works at Tutuka Power Station, Mpumalanga
Eskom is proposing to construct additional infrastructure at the existing Tutuka Power Station, approximately 22 km north east of Standerton, Mpumalanga for the treatment of groundwater and wastewater. The treatment facilities would consist of two components; namely a brine (referred to hereinafter as reject) concentration plant and a groundwater wastewater treatment works (WWTW). This proposed project triggers a number of listed activities in terms of National Environmental Management Act (No. 107 of 1998)(NEMA) and National Environmental Management: Waste Act (No. 59 of 2008) and accordingly requires environmental authorisation and a waste management licence from DEA via the EIA process outlined in Regulation 385 of NEMA. Aurecon has been appointed to undertake the required environmental authorisation and licencing processes on Eskom’s behalf.
Current Project Phase
The Final EIAR has been completed, and all I&AP comments have been incorporated into the report, the document will be submitted to DEA, who must, within 60 days, do one of the following: If the report is accepted, DEA must within 45 days: (a) Grant authorisation in respect of all or part of the activity applied for; or (b) Refuse authorisation in respect of all or part of the activity. Once DEA have made their decision on the proposed project, all registered I&APs on the project database will be notified of the outcome of the decision within ten calendar days of the Environmental Authorisation having been issued. Should anyone (a member of public, registered I&AP or the Applicant) wish to appeal DEA’s decision, a Notice of Intention to Appeal in terms of Section 62 of NEMA must be lodged with the Minister of Water and Environmental Affairs within 10 calendar days of the I&AP being notified. As noted previously a 21 day comment period on the Final EIAR will also be given. However any comments received will not be included in a CRR and will instead be collated and forwarded directly to DEA.
